WebAmerican Beautyberry prefers light shade or protection from the afternoon sun in Oklahoma. It grows from 5 to 10' high and just as broad but overgrown plants can be rejuvenated by cutting them to the ground in winter without sacrificing fruit since the flowers are produced on new growth. WebAmerican beautyberry is a short-lived shrub, typically growing for 10-15 years. Keep that in mind when choosing where to use it in your landscape.
